This week, PBS News introduced a podcast series titled In Pursuit of Happiness, hosted by Judy Woodruff. It spans six episodes and delves into the individuals, culture, and ideas that shaped America.
In a segment from the inaugural episode, presidential historian Lindsay Chervinsky offers a new perspective on President George Washington. She discusses his belief that embracing diverse viewpoints enhanced his leadership.
“George Washington thought diverse opinions were vital in making more robust decisions,” Chervinsky noted. “He intentionally surrounded himself with people who held different perspectives.”
About Judy Woodruff
Judy Woodruff, the podcast host, is a senior correspondent at PBS News. She previously served as anchor and managing editor of the PBS News Hour. Over her five-decade-long career, she has reported on politics and various other news at NBC, CNN, and PBS.
